  • ...perhaps it would be less pronounced with a quicker backswing. Try something for me: Stand up with your feet shoulder width and slowly shift your weight from left to right repeatedly, like one whole second between shifts. You'll have to sway to stay balanced. Now speed up. You'll notice that the faster you shift your weight, the less swaying is required, until at a brisk swing speed, almost NO lateral movement is needed to shift ALL your weight between feet. I hope this helps. Good luck.

  • Pretty good swing bro. I would work to stop the move to the right on your back swing. Not in the upper body, but in the hips. I had the same slide and my ball striking improved greatly after the fix. As you start back, feel as if your left hip actually moves forward (toward the target) just a little bit. You will find it much easier to get back to your left side. It helps to get the sensation of the left hip moving forward if you put it in your waggle. watch E. Ells' waggle to see what i mean.

  • Potentially a very good player, the "downcock" you generate is a real gift you don't see that often. You sway off the ball going back though, looks like this is due to ball position being too far back. You may benefit from the Faldo method of playing everything off the left instep and varying stance width not ball position. Read Faldo's book "a swing for life" for a better description.
